Early Career Highlights

Sharon Gless began her career in the late 1960s, appearing in various television shows. Her early work included guest appearances on series such as "The Rookies" and "Marcus Welby, M.D." However, it was her role as Christine Cagney in the groundbreaking series "Cagney & Lacey" that catapulted her to stardom.

Rise to Fame

"Cagney & Lacey," which aired from 1981 to 1988, was notable for its strong female leads and realistic portrayal of women's experiences in law enforcement. Gless's performance earned her critical acclaim and several awards, including two Primetime Emmy Awards.
